Pune to Get Twin Tunnel Corridor, Marking a New Era in Urban Transit
Pune is set to witness a significant leap in urban transportation with the proposed twin tunnel underground corridor linking Yerawada to Katraj. Maharashtra Chief Minister Devendra Fadnavis has instructed the Pune Metropolitan Region Development Authority (PMRDA) to draft a detailed proposal for this transformative infrastructure project. The decision was taken at a high-level meeting at Sahyadri State Guest House in Mumbai, where urban development strategies for Pune, Nashik, Nagpur, and Chhatrapati Sambhaji Nagar were reviewed. With Pune’s traffic congestion worsening due to rapid urbanisation, this tunnel corridor aims to provide a seamless commuting experience while leveraging cutting-edge engineering solutions.
The twin tunnel project is poised to become a game-changer in Pune’s transport landscape, integrating modern technology to enhance mobility and connectivity. The directive comes alongside substantial allocations for infrastructure development, including ₹636.84 crore for road networks to the upcoming Purandar Airport, ₹203 crore for cement roads in Ranjangaon and Hinjawadi, and a ₹1,526 crore investment in road networks across Urban Growth Centres. Fadnavis has also underscored the importance of future-proofing Pune’s roads, mandating a minimum width of 18 metres for new city developments to accommodate rising urban density. The Chief Minister further acknowledged Pune Mahanagar Parivahan Mahamandal Limited’s (PMPML) proposal for 500 new CNG buses, a move aimed at bolstering public transport while reducing carbon emissions.
Urban and Civic Challenges: A Comparative Outlook
Pune’s infrastructure challenges mirror those of other rapidly expanding urban centres like Bengaluru and Hyderabad, where road congestion remains a persistent issue. The underground corridor is expected to alleviate pressure on arterial roads, similar to the impact of metro rail expansions in other cities. However, effective execution will be critical—Mumbai’s coastal road project, for instance, faced delays due to environmental clearances and funding constraints. The Pune administration must ensure a smooth rollout by proactively addressing land acquisition and project financing concerns. Additionally, civic bodies will need to collaborate on minimising disruptions during construction, as past experiences with metro projects have shown that prolonged development phases often lead to commuter dissatisfaction.
With this in mind, the state government is adopting a more integrated approach to urban planning, ensuring that infrastructure upgrades cater to long-term mobility demands. The meeting also focused on regional priorities, such as reserving land for wastewater treatment in Nashik, advancing plans for Nagpur’s office-residential complex in Sondapar, and enhancing industrial and tourism zones in Chhatrapati Sambhaji Nagar. These initiatives reflect a broader vision to elevate Maharashtra’s urban centres into more resilient and sustainable hubs.
Sustainability: A Key Consideration in Pune’s Development
Beyond its impact on traffic decongestion, the twin tunnel corridor aligns with Pune’s broader sustainability goals. The introduction of such a high-tech, underground infrastructure solution is expected to reduce vehicular emissions by encouraging smoother traffic flow and minimising idle time on congested roads. Given that Pune ranks among India’s top cities with deteriorating air quality due to vehicular pollution, a well-executed tunnel corridor could be instrumental in improving environmental health. The planned procurement of 500 CNG buses further strengthens the city’s transition to eco-friendly transport solutions, a move in line with global trends seen in urban centres like Singapore and London, where low-emission transit networks are becoming the norm.
Moreover, urban tunnel projects have demonstrated sustainability benefits in other regions. For instance, the implementation of underground corridors in European cities has helped reduce noise pollution and preserve green spaces by eliminating the need for extensive surface road expansions. Pune stands to benefit similarly, provided the project incorporates environmental safeguards such as efficient ventilation and energy-efficient lighting systems. If executed with sustainability at its core, the twin tunnel corridor could serve as a model for other Indian cities grappling with similar urban transport challenges.
